MEMO — Kettling Depot Receiving

Uniform sets for the new Kettling depot arrive Wednesday via Ashgrove courier: 40 boxes, sorted by size, manifest attached to box one. Check the count at the dock before signing; shortages go straight to stores, not the courier. The hand-over instruction the courier will follow is set out below.

drop instructions, tafof-baguf: the holmir gilox courier leaves the sormir ulaok holdor ledger at gate 5596 under passcode 257343

TURN-208: Gatevale turnstile counters at the Merrow Field pilot double-count when a rotation reverses mid-cycle. Attendance totals drift roughly 2% high per event. The debounce window fix is implemented, reviewed by Ilsa, and soak-tested across two simulated match days without drift. Ready for your cut; the candidate build is identified below.

trace token, tagag-tafog: htk6_5ed18c

Handover Note — Dept Heads
From: Director Halvorsen. To: Director Mbeki-Crane.
The Lumera Plus tier launches next quarter. Pricing approved; billing integration at Verdan Systems is 80% complete. Marketing collateral pending sign-off from Tessa Ravn. Churn modelling suggests a 6% uplift in retained accounts. Outstanding: tier migration rules for legacy Stonebrook contracts, and support staffing for the Keldport office. Resolve both before the review on the 14th. Confidential business plan context follows below.

internal memo for bahap-yagug: Headcount on the Ulaix team goes from 3 to 100 by the end of January. Gross margin on Ulaix came in at 10 percent against a plan of 15 percent.